Regardless of the material from which the house is built, its foundation must comply with all the rules. Each building has its own optimal base design. As practice has shown, a pile foundation for a house made of timber is the most suitable option.
The main enemy of the building is the accumulation of soil during freezing, the volume of which can increase by 12%. The load on the foundation increases significantly and can exceed the design. In addition, it is affected by groundwater. All these factors are taken into account when choosing the type of foundation. If the load from the load-bearing walls is small, it can be lightened.

How to build a pile foundation
The foundation process begins with marking and drilling. The distances between them and the diameter depend on the design load. In this case, wells should be placed at the corners of the future home and at the intersections of the bearing walls. They can be made manually (up to 6 m deep) and mechanized drill (electric or diesel).
Then the wells are filled with concrete. It is advisable to install pipes from a triple layer of roofing material in them, connected by a wire from above and protruding above the ground to a height of 30 cm. Asbestos-cement pipes can be used as formwork. The smooth outer surface of the piles reduces loads during heaving. In addition, cement milk does not go into the ground, and the strength of the piles becomes higher.
A reinforcing cage is installed inside. He should be at the height of the future grillage.
Concrete is poured into the well and compacted using a vibrator. After solidification, the piles are combined into one solid structure using a grillage. It can be placed on the ground, transferring part of the load to the soil (low). A high grillage is located above the ground, and the entire load is perceived by piles. It can be monolithic or prefabricated. Since the grillage between piles perceives tensile loads, it is reinforced.
Errors in laying the foundation
It happens that a pile foundation for a house from a bar is erected with the following errors.
- If there is no connection between the pillars and the grillage, the expansion of the soil in winter can displace them and cause damage to the house. Often this happens with light buildings.
- No gap between grillage and soil. Clustering can tear off piles and destroy the foundation. You can put insulation on the bottom of the formwork.
- Shallow foundation piling. As a result, the foundation may shift, and the cavity between the soil and the grillage will disappear.
- The lack of an accurate calculation of the bearing capacity can lead to constant immersion of the foundation in the ground.

Construction of houses on screw piles
The pile is a pipe with a pointed end and a welded blade in the form of a spiral. It is used for building a house on a pile-screw foundation.
One standard pile can withstand a load of 3-5 tons for clay soil and 5-8 for sand.
Screwing in is carried out using a tractor or excavator. Then the pile is cut to a predetermined level and poured with concrete. As a result, it serves as external reinforcement. With a pipe wall thickness of 6-8 mm, concrete can not be poured.
When a screw pile foundation is built for a wooden house, there is no need for a reinforced concrete grillage. It can be made from a metal profile welded around the perimeter, or from wood.
The base of the pile foundation of a house made of timber is easiest to make mounted. To do this, guides are attached or welded to the piles, and then sheathed with sheet material. It can be made double, with placement inside the insulation, or install thermal panels.
Then the underground space will be warm, which significantly affects the microclimate of the first floor. The place of contact of the casing with the soil is poured with sand to a depth of 400-700 mm.
